Investment highlights and platform overview

  • QUELIMMUNE Selective Cytopheretic Device (SCD) is FDA approved for pediatric acute kidney injury (AKI) with sepsis under a humanitarian device exemption since 2024.

  • The SCD platform targets immune-related renal injuries and is being commercialized for children, with a pipeline expanding into multiple adult indications under breakthrough device designation.

  • Adult AKI market opportunity is estimated at $4.5 billion annually, with over 200,000 patients in the U.S. each year.

  • The device modulates immune response by selectively binding and neutralizing activated neutrophils and monocytes, reducing hyperinflammation without immunosuppression.

  • Clinical data show improved survival rates and no dialysis dependency at 60 days in both pediatric and adult populations.

Clinical development and results

  • The pivotal NEUTRALIZE-AKI trial for adults is 60% enrolled, targeting a 200-patient randomized controlled study with a 90-day endpoint of mortality or dialysis dependency.

  • Interim analysis of the first 100 patients is expected in Q3, with final PMA submission planned for the second half of 2026.

  • Early pediatric registry data show a 75% survival rate and reduced hospital stays, with no device-related serious adverse events or infections.

  • The pediatric product launched in July 2024 and is being adopted by leading U.S. children's hospitals, with a focus on the top 50 centers.

  • The same device mechanism is used across pediatric and adult indications, with size adjustments for children.

Commercial strategy and financials

  • Direct sales and distribution model eliminates middleman fees, aiming for optimal hospital and customer experience.

  • Hospitals using SCD in children see reduced length of stay and cost savings, supporting commercial adoption.

  • Expansion plans include reaching 20 pediatric hospital systems in 2025 and completing adult pivotal study enrollment.

  • Additional $8.6 million in capital was raised in July, with no interest-bearing debt and a clean capital structure.
